请求参数上报过程中如何保证数据安全性?
在互联网高速发展的今天,数据已经成为企业的重要资产。然而,数据在传输过程中面临着诸多安全风险,尤其是请求参数上报过程中,如何保证数据安全性成为了企业关注的焦点。本文将围绕这一主题,探讨在请求参数上报过程中如何确保数据安全。
一、了解请求参数上报过程
请求参数上报是指将用户在客户端提交的数据,通过HTTP请求发送到服务器端的过程。这一过程涉及数据采集、传输、存储等多个环节,任何一个环节出现问题,都可能导致数据泄露或被篡改。
二、数据安全风险分析
- 数据泄露:在请求参数上报过程中,数据可能被黑客窃取,导致用户隐私泄露。
- 数据篡改:黑客可能对传输过程中的数据进行篡改,影响业务正常运行。
- 数据损坏:由于网络不稳定或其他原因,数据在传输过程中可能损坏,导致业务无法正常运行。
三、保证数据安全性的方法
数据加密:对请求参数进行加密处理,确保数据在传输过程中的安全性。常用的加密算法有AES、RSA等。
- AES加密:对称加密算法,速度快,适用于大量数据的加密。
- RSA加密:非对称加密算法,安全性高,适用于小量数据的加密。
HTTPS协议:使用HTTPS协议进行数据传输,确保数据在传输过程中的安全性。
- SSL/TLS证书:HTTPS协议需要SSL/TLS证书进行加密,提高数据传输的安全性。
参数签名:对请求参数进行签名,确保数据的完整性和一致性。
- HMAC算法:常用的签名算法,安全性高。
数据压缩:对数据进行压缩,减少数据传输过程中的延迟和带宽消耗。
- GZIP压缩:常用的数据压缩算法,压缩效果好。
安全传输通道:使用VPN、SSH等安全传输通道,确保数据在传输过程中的安全性。
四、案例分析
某电商平台在请求参数上报过程中,采用以下措施保证数据安全性:
- 使用AES加密算法对请求参数进行加密。
- 使用HTTPS协议进行数据传输。
- 对请求参数进行HMAC签名。
- 使用GZIP压缩算法对数据进行压缩。
- 使用VPN进行安全传输。
通过以上措施,该电商平台有效保证了请求参数上报过程中的数据安全性,降低了数据泄露、篡改等风险。
五、总结
在请求参数上报过程中,保证数据安全性至关重要。通过数据加密、HTTPS协议、参数签名、数据压缩、安全传输通道等措施,可以有效降低数据安全风险,确保企业数据资产的安全。
猜你喜欢:网络可视化